A brief history of reggae music, and the tradition of what the islanders play for parties today includes the introduction of large PA systems into the West Indies.

The concept has never left and is the way of the islands today. As early as the late 50's, the new technology made it to the islands and brought people in to town, the beach or wherever the music was going to be. It was a major coup back in the day and nobody has let go.

I remember staying at the Liberty Inn on Simpson Bay one quiet Sunday night. The restaurant next door had 2 sound systems going, full blast and not a customer in sight. When I went to ask why, I was told the music was loud "So the customers would come in". This was 11 pm. No dancing ladies, smelly bar, I am pretty sure it didn't work
